Lock and Key - A Mini-Book for 5e, PF2, and Savage Worlds

Created by Matthew J. Hanson

A 5e, PF2, SW mini-supplement about stopping people from stealing your stuff. History, variant locks, monsters, magic items, and more!

Future Books

Meanwhile work continues on Rope and Chain. I'm about two thirds of the way done and with Lock and Key out I have more time to focus on this. I should be able to finish the writing by the end of the month and have it out as a PDF in July. Here is the updated outline, starred items are already written. There's also still room for a little more if you have other things you'd like to see.

  • *A Brief History of Rope
  • *A Brief History of Chain
  • Rope in Fantasy Settings
  • Variant Ropes: *Dwarven Steel Rope, *Mithral Chain, *Adamatine Chain, Maybe more?
  • *Optional Rules: Tying knots/tying up prisoners
  • How much weight can a rope hold?
  • *New Weapons: Lasso, harpoon, rope dart, and meteor hammer 
  • Random Rope Generator (Partially done)
  • New Spells: *Animate Rope, *Raska's Restrictive Ribbons
  • New Magic Items: *Lasso of Honesty, *Ghost Chain, (One or two others.)
  • New Monsters: *Snimic – Half snake, half mimic, *Rope Golem, *Chain Golem, (One more?)

I've also stared to do a little work on Code and Cypher. The most concrete thing I've done is write up a single magic item, inspired by the Voynich manuscript. It's a crazy magic book that your character can slowly decode, with each page revealing something new based on a random table. I think that soon I'll be posting a preview of it on the Patreon Page.

Because I know you are always looking for more crowdfunding opportunities, I want to give a plug for Magical Kitties Level Up! I'm not running this one, but I am involved as a writer/game designer.

Magical Kitties is an all-ages RPG, where the players take on the roll of kitties with magical powers that must defend their humans from witches, aliens, and the school bully. This is a great way to introduce your kids to RPGs or play a light-hearted game with adults.

The Level Up Kickstarter campaign expands the original games with new books and accessories, and also includes pledge levels with the base game.
